  • The US has intensified its military actions against Iran's port city of Bandar Abbas, particularly following renewed missile strikes between the two nations. Notably, this includes a significant sea drone attack targeting a submarine maintenance facility.
  • The strategic importance of Bandar Abbas, a city with over half a million residents, has made it a focal point for US military operations.
  • Bandar Abbas serves as a critical hub for Iran's naval operations and trade, making it a strategic target in the ongoing conflict. The renewed missile strikes and drone attacks reflect the heightened military posturing from both sides amidst an already volatile geopolitical landscape.
  • The escalation of hostilities in Bandar Abbas highlights the increasing tensions between the US and Iran. The use of naval drones signifies a shift in military strategy, aiming to undermine Iran's naval capabilities while sending a clear message of deterrence.
